Health and mental balance through balanced sleep

It is possible to maintain health and mental balance with good sleep, but more or less sleep can cause harm. According to experts, both quantity and quality of sleep should be balanced. Sleeping at regular time, distance from mobile and calm environment helps in increasing the quality of sleep. Balanced sleep reduces fatigue, stress and health risks.

World Sleep Day 2026: Experts say that 8 hours of sleep is not necessary for every person. The need for sleep depends on age, lifestyle and physical activities. Less sleep can cause fatigue, mood swings and heart disease, while too much sleep can lead to laziness and lack of energy. Balanced and quality sleep provides complete rest to both body and mind and makes daily routine more productive.

Harm from too much or less sleep

Lack of sleep can lead to fatigue, mood swings, lack of focus and increased stress throughout the day. Prolonged lack of sleep can lead to obesity, diabetes, heart disease and mental health problems. At the same time, taking excessive sleep can cause problems like laziness, lack of energy and sometimes depression. Therefore balanced sleep is important to maintain health and quality of life.

Sleep quality also matters

Just getting enough sleep is not enough. Deep and peaceful sleep provides complete relief to the body and mind. Superficial or intermittent sleep does not reduce fatigue and stress. For better sleep, it is important to sleep at a regular time, stay away from mobile phones and screens before sleeping and ensure a calm, comfortable environment.

maintain the right balance of sleep

Every person should create a balance according to his sleep habits and needs. Adequate and quality sleep maintains energy, reduces mental stress and makes daily routine more productive. It is beneficial not only for physical health but also for mental freshness and quality of life.
